WebSee Guideline on Pathology testing in the Emergency department: Appendix 2. Abdominal pain severe (lower) Consider: Blood culture, Urea, Electrolytes, Creatinine, Glucose, Calcium, Phosphate, Albumin, Beta HCG quantitation (female), Full blood count. Consider Blood group and antibody screen if female. Consider L-Lactate. Ward test urine and MCS. WebAlthough chest pain is a common symptom in children, ... WebThere is typically dull, deep, and severe epigastric pain, which may radiate to the back, or localize to the right or left upper quadrants. It may be relieved by sitting upright and leaning forward, and is often precipitated by eating.
